Color Conversions
| Format | Value | CSS Usage | |
|---|---|---|---|
| HSL | hsl(198, 80%, 62%) | color: hsl(198, 80%, 62%) | |
| HEX | #51BDEC | color: #51BDEC | |
| RGB | rgb(81, 189, 236) | color: rgb(81, 189, 236) | |
| CMYK | cmyk(66%, 20%, 0%, 7%) | — | |
| HSV | hsv(198, 66%, 93%) | — | |
| HWB | hwb(198 32% 7%) | color: hwb(198 32% 7%) | |
| OKLCH | oklch(0.7547 0.1188 229.96) | color: oklch(0.7547 0.1188 229.96) | |
| Lab | lab(72.36 -16.68 -32.48) | color: lab(72.36 -16.68 -32.48) | |
| LCH | lch(72.36 36.51 242.82) | color: lch(72.36 36.51 242.82) |

Frequently Asked Questions
What are all the color codes for HSL(198, 80%, 62%)?
HEX: #51BDEC | RGB: rgb(81, 189, 236) | CMYK: 66%, 20%, 0%, 7% | HSV: 198°, 66%, 93%. Copy any format from the conversion table above.
What colors go well with #51BDEC?
The complementary color is HSL(18, 80%, 62%). For a triadic harmony, use hues 198°, 318°, and 78°. For analogous combinations, try hues 168° and 228°. See the Color Harmony section above for complete palettes with previews.
How do I use HSL(198, 80%, 62%) in CSS?
As HSL: color: hsl(198, 80%, 62%); — As HEX: color: #51BDEC; — As RGB: color: rgb(81, 189, 236); — Tailwind CSS: bg-[hsl(198,80%,62%)] — CSS variable: --color-primary: hsl(198, 80%, 62%);
